在这个由硬件与软件交织而成的复杂生态系统中,服务器内存作为服务器性能的核心组件之一,扮演着举足轻重的角色
面对“服务器机房需要服务器内存吗”这一看似简单实则深刻的问题,答案无疑是肯定的,且其必要性远远超出了基本功能需求的范畴
本文将从服务器内存的基本功能、对服务器机房性能的影响、以及在现代应用场景中的不可或缺性三个方面,深入剖析为何服务器机房绝对需要服务器内存
一、服务器内存:性能与效率的基石 服务器内存,即随机存取存储器(RAM),是服务器中用于暂时存储数据和指令的硬件设备
与硬盘等持久性存储设备不同,内存的数据访问速度极快,能够在几纳秒内完成数据的读写操作,这对于处理大量并发请求、执行复杂计算任务至关重要
在服务器机房中,每一台服务器都是数据处理链条上的关键节点,而内存则是这些节点高效运转的驱动力
1.提升数据处理速度:服务器内存的高速访问特性,使得CPU能够迅速获取所需数据,从而加快数据处理速度
在大数据处理、实时分析、在线交易等高负载应用场景中,这一点尤为重要
2.支持多任务并发:服务器机房往往需要同时处理来自不同用户、不同应用的多个请求
充足的内存容量能够确保操作系统和应用程序在同时运行时不会因内存不足而频繁进行磁盘交换(即“虚拟内存”操作),从而显著提升系统响应时间和整体效率
3.优化缓存机制:服务器内存还承担着缓存数据的角色,包括数据库缓存、Web缓存等,这些缓存机制能够减少重复数据访问,降低磁盘I/O负担,进一步提升系统性能
二、对服务器机房性能的影响:从微观到宏观的变革 服务器内存不仅直接影响单台服务器的性能,更在宏观层面决定了整个服务器机房的运算能力、稳定性和可扩展性
1.运算能力提升:在高性能计算(HPC)、云计算、人工智能等领域,服务器机房需要处理的数据量呈指数级增长
增加内存容量,尤其是采用高性能的DDR4、DDR5等新一代内存技术,可以显著提升服务器的浮点运算能力和数据处理吞吐量,满足大规模数据处理的需求
2.系统稳定性增强:内存不足是导致服务器宕机、应用崩溃的主要原因之一
在服务器机房环境中,任何一台服务器的故障都可能引发连锁反应,影响整个系统的稳定性和可用性
因此,合理配置足够的内存容量,可以有效减少因内存耗尽导致的系统异常,提高整体系统的稳定性和可靠性
3.可扩展性与灵活性:随着业务的发展,服务器机房需要不断扩容以满足日益增长的数据处理需求
良好的内存架构设计,如支持ECC(错误校正码)的内存模块,不仅提高了数据的准确性,还为未来的硬件升级提供了更大的灵活性
此外,模块化设计使得内存可以按需增减,便于实现资源的动态分配和优化
三、现代应用场景中的不可或缺性 在数字化转型的浪潮下,服务器机房正面临着前所未有的挑战与机遇
从云计算、大数据、物联网到人工智能,这些新兴技术的应用无一不依赖于强大的数据处理能力,而服务器内存正是这一能力的核心支撑
1.云计算平台:云计算的核心在于资源的灵活调度和按需分配
服务器机房作为云服务的物理基础,其内存资源的充足与否直接关系到云服务的性能和用户体验
高密度的内存配置能够支持更多的虚拟机实例,提高资源利用率,降低运营成本
2.大数据分析:大数据分析依赖于快速的数据读取、处理和存储能力
内存数据库、分布式缓存等技术的兴起,使得内存成为大数据分析加速的关键
通过增加内存容量和优化内存使用策略,可以显著提高数据分析的实时性和准确性
3.人工智能与机器学习:AI和ML模型训练需要大量的计算资源和内存空间
深度学习框架如TensorFlow、PyTorch等,在训练过程中会占用大量内存来存储模型参数、中间结果等
因此,高性能、大容量的服务器内存对于加速模型训练、提升模型精度至关重要
4.物联网(IoT):随着物联网设备的普及,服务器机房需要处理的数据量激增
物联网应用往往要求低延迟、高可靠性的数据传输和处理,这同样依赖于高效的内存管理机制和充足的内存容量
综上所述,服务器机房需要服务器内存,这不仅是技术层面的必然需求,更是推动数字化转型、实现业务创新的关键所在
在构建高效、稳定、可扩展的服务器机房时,必须充分考虑内存资源的合理配置与优化,以确保系统能够应对未来复杂多变的业务需求,为企业的发展提供坚实的数字基石
在这个数据为王的时代,服务器内存不仅是服务器机房的“心脏”,更是驱动数字化转型、开启智能未来的强大引擎